    Update: I believe I have fixed the swap issue and the boot issue in unstable. This fix will roll out for the next sync. However, if you want this working now you can edit /etc/systemd/system.conf and change:

    #DefaultTimeoutStartSec=5s

    To:

    DefaultTimeoutStartSec=30s

    And:

    #DefaultDeviceTimeoutSec=5s

    To:

    DefaultDeviceTimeoutSec=30s

    Note the removal of the # symbol. This should fix it immediately and things should work again on the next boot.
